Although feedings are crucial for saving life of Pygmy kids, additional care is also required. Sickly kids are often abandoned by the does. So monitor the baby goat to ensure a rectal temperature of 101.5° to 103.5° Fahrenheit. Place a goat with low body temperature in warm water.

How Much Does a Pygmy Goat Cost? The purchasing cost of a Pygmy Goat will fall somewhere between $100 to $400. The cost may fluctuate depending upon the goat’s age, size, color, breed, and sex. In addition, their initial setup (housing) would easily cost up to $500. Straw is much warmer and insulates goats from the ground much better than pine shavings, so if you can find straw in your area, it's the best choice for winter bedding. African Pygmy goats are small in size, averaging 15 to 20 inches tall (38.1 to 50.8 centimeters) at the shoulder. Females weigh about 23 to 34 kilograms, (35 to 50 pounds) and males about 27 to 39 kg (40 to 60 pounds). Feb 19, 2024 · Hay should form the bulk of your goat’s daily feed, making up to 40%. Goats bred for milking should consume more hay than others do, with experts recommending feeding milking goats up to 9 pounds of hay per day. For other goats, 4 pounds of hay per day should be enough. When it comes to the choice of hay, Alfalfa is the best, as it contains ... border collie pups for sale near me The BoSe dosage for goats is as follows: Adults: 2.5 cc/ 100 lbs . Kids: .5 cc (miniature breeds .25 cc) How to Give BoSe. BoSe is given by injection. To give BoSe to an adult goat you will need the following: BoSe supplement (Rx) A livestock scale or goat weight tape; A syringe; An 18-20 gauge needle . When breeding the doe, look for estrus. Tail-wagging, bleating, and a mucus discharge from the vulva are some common signs of goat reproduction. She will have an estrus cycle approximately every 20 days. Phosphorus deficiency in grazing goats is more likely than a calcium deficiency. The organization was founded in 1976 and promotes pygmy goats by setting official breed standards, provides animal registration, maintains a database of pedigrees, certifies judges, and sanctions pygmy goat shows around the United States.
